ASHCROFT VOWS TO STAY SOLO
THE VERVE frontman RICHARD ASHCROFT has vowed to continue with his solo career - despite recently reforming the rock band.
The Bitter Sweet Symphony hitmakers first split in 1995, before reuniting briefly in 1996, and then reforming again in 1997.
They staged their latest comeback this year (08) to play a series of live dates and release a new album.
But Ashcroft insists the reunion will not be permanent.
He says, "I will continue my solo stuff. But it seemed a shame to leave this thing dormant when there is so much talent there."
